The Precision Instruments Peptide Protocols
Peptides are short chains of amino acids that act as highly specific signaling molecules. They represent the next frontier in biological optimization, allowing for the fine-tuning of processes that hormones govern more broadly. They work by targeting specific receptors to initiate a cascade of desired effects, from stimulating growth hormone release to accelerating tissue repair.
- Growth Hormone Secretagogues (GHS): This class of peptides stimulates the pituitary gland to produce and release the body’s own growth hormone. This is a more nuanced approach than direct GH injection, as it works within the body’s natural pulsatile rhythm.
- CJC-1295 & Ipamorelin: This is a cornerstone stack for body recomposition. CJC-1295 provides a sustained elevation in GH levels, while Ipamorelin provides a strong, clean pulse of GH release without significantly impacting cortisol or other hormones. The combination promotes lean muscle gain and accelerates fat loss.
- Tesamorelin: Initially developed to treat visceral fat accumulation, Tesamorelin is highly effective at targeting stubborn abdominal fat while promoting lean mass.
